High-pressure metallic β-Sn silicon (Si-II), depending on temperature, decompression rate, stress, etc., may transform to diverse metastable forms with promising semiconducting properties under decompression. However, the underlying mechanisms governing the different transformation paths are not well understood. Here, two distinctive pathways, viz., a thermally activated crystal-crystal transition and a mechanically driven amorphization, were characterized under rapid decompression of Si-II at various temperatures using in situ time-resolved x-ray diffraction. Under slow decompression, Si-II transforms to a crystalline bc8/r8 phase in the pressure range of 4.3-9.2 GPa through a thermally activated process where the overdepressurization and the onset transition strain are strongly dependent on decompression rate and temperature. In comparison, Si-II collapses structurally to an amorphous form at around 4.3 GPa when the volume expansion approaches a critical strain via rapid decompression beyond a threshold rate. The occurrence of the critical strain indicates a limit of the structural metastability of Si-II, which separates the thermally activated and mechanically driven transition processes. The results show the coupled effect of decompression rate, activation barrier, and thermal energy on the adopted transformation paths, providing atomistic insight into the competition between equilibrium and nonequilibrium pathways and the resulting metastable phases.

Background: Despite widespread adoption of ketamine into enhanced recovery after surgery (ERAS) protocols, research regarding its specific impact on perioperative outcomes is limited. This pragmatic, randomised, double-blind, placebo-controlled, single-cluster trial evaluated the impact of ketamine on postoperative outcomes in patients undergoing major abdominal surgery within an established ERAS protocol.
Methods: Male and female patients, aged ≥18 yr, were randomised to ketamine or saline placebo bolus at induction of general anaesthesia, followed by an intraoperative and postoperative infusion for 48 h.

Oncologic emergencies in critically ill cancer patients frequently require rapid, real-time assessment of tumor responses to therapeutic interventions. However, conventional imaging modalities such as computed tomography and magnetic resonance imaging are often impractical in intensive care units (ICUs) due to logistical constraints and patient instability. Super-resolution ultrasound (SR-US) imaging has emerged as a promising noninvasive alternative, facilitating bedside evaluation of tumor microvascular dynamics with exceptional spatial resolution.

Diffuse sclerosing osteomyelitis (DSO) is a rare, chronic aseptic osteomyelitis of the mandible characterized by resistance to conventional therapies including nonsteroidal anti-inflammatory drugs (NSAIDs), antibiotics, corticosteroids, and surgery. Diagnosis is often delayed due to nonspecific symptoms and lack of typical infectious signs, sometimes resulting in misdiagnosis. We report a case of a 58-year-old male patient with persistent mandibular pain initially misdiagnosed as trigeminal neuralgia and treated with microvascular decompression surgery without improvement.

Objective: Trigeminal neuralgia (TN) is characterized by recurrent, unilateral episodes of electric shock-like facial pain, frequently triggered by routine activities, that can significantly impair quality of life. Although interventions such as microvascular decompression, stereotactic radiosurgery, and minimally invasive percutaneous procedures often provide rapid pain relief, recurrence remains a clinical challenge. Psychological comorbidities, particularly depressive disorder, may play a role in predicting outcomes after surgical intervention.
